Speaker Bio: Estelle Tracy is a chocolate sommelier based in Kennett Square. Originally from France, she discovered the world of bean-to-bar chocolate after reviewing 37 chocolate bars in honor of her 37th birthday on Halloween 2015. The challenge opened her eyes to the unique flavors, stories, and makers behind craft chocolate. Since then, she’s shared this world with others through hundreds of tastings around the globe. Tracy is also the author of a food survival guide for French people in the US and the founder of 37 Chocolates, a chocolate education company.
